Aims and Scopes

The journal 'Cognitive Computation and Systems' is dedicated to advancing the understanding and application of cognitive computing and intelligent systems. It encompasses a broad spectrum of interdisciplinary research that merges cognitive science with computational methodologies to address complex challenges across various domains.
  1. Cognitive Computing Approaches:
    Focuses on the development and application of cognitive models and systems, employing artificial intelligence and machine learning techniques to mimic human cognitive processes.
  2. Data Fusion and Processing:
    Explores methodologies for integrating and analyzing multi-modal data sources, enhancing decision-making processes in areas such as healthcare, robotics, and smart systems.
  3. Robotics and Autonomous Systems:
    Investigates the design and implementation of intelligent robotic systems that can operate autonomously, with emphasis on perception, navigation, and interaction with humans.
  4. Human-Machine Interaction:
    Studies the dynamics of interactions between humans and machines, including user experience, emotion recognition, and adaptive systems that respond to user inputs.
  5. Neuroscience and Cognitive Modeling:
    Integrates insights from neuroscience to develop cognitive models that inform artificial intelligence systems, with applications in areas such as brain-computer interfaces and cognitive load assessment.
  6. Optimization Techniques in AI:
    Applies various optimization techniques to enhance the performance of AI models, focusing on areas such as neural networks, reinforcement learning, and algorithm efficiency.
The journal has identified several emerging themes that reflect current trends in cognitive computation and systems. These trends highlight the journal's commitment to addressing contemporary challenges and advancing innovative methodologies.
  1. Blockchain Applications in Cognitive Systems:
    Recent publications indicate a rising interest in applying blockchain technology to cognitive systems, particularly in areas like secure data sharing and decentralized decision-making processes.
  2. Multi-Modal Learning and Fusion Techniques:
    There is a significant increase in research related to multi-modal learning, where various types of data inputs are integrated to improve model accuracy and robustness, particularly in fields like healthcare and autonomous systems.
  3. Deep Reinforcement Learning:
    The trend towards deep reinforcement learning is growing, with an emphasis on real-time decision-making and adaptive control in dynamic environments such as robotics and autonomous vehicles.
  4. Emotion Recognition and Affective Computing:
    Emerging research focuses on emotion recognition through physiological signals and machine learning, highlighting the importance of understanding human emotions in human-computer interaction.
  5. Generative Models and Adversarial Networks:
    The application of generative adversarial networks (GANs) is on the rise, showcasing innovative uses in fields such as image generation, anomaly detection, and simulation of complex systems.

Declining or Waning

While the journal has seen significant growth in various research areas, certain themes appear to be losing traction. These declining scopes reflect shifts in focus, possibly due to evolving technologies and changing research priorities.
  1. Traditional Machine Learning Techniques:
    There is a noticeable decline in the publication of papers focused solely on traditional machine learning techniques, as the field moves towards more advanced methodologies such as deep learning and hybrid approaches.
  2. Basic Image Processing Techniques:
    Papers concentrating on basic image processing methods are becoming less frequent, likely overshadowed by more complex and integrative approaches that combine multiple modalities and advanced neural networks.
  3. Static Cognitive Models:
    Research focusing on static or simplistic cognitive models is waning, as the field increasingly emphasizes dynamic systems capable of learning and adapting in real-time.
  4. Single-Modal Data Analysis:
    There is a reduced emphasis on studies that analyze single-modal data, as the trend shifts towards multi-modal approaches that provide richer insights and more robust solutions.
  5. Non-AI Driven Cognitive Systems:
    The exploration of cognitive systems that do not incorporate AI is declining, reflecting the growing dominance of AI technologies in cognitive computation.
